Transaction 593d02079f5fe4b7143a3a43d20a8c8e0cc7d1f979a076bcaa421f5702e30285
2 Input
2 Outputs
- 593d02079f5fe4b7143a3a43d20a8c8e0cc7d1f979a076bcaa421f5702e30285:0
- 593d02079f5fe4b7143a3a43d20a8c8e0cc7d1f979a076bcaa421f5702e30285:1
value 29252565
address 1PTNHpVHhGrmhXC7bBP8BzL24mnN7CXDvy
value 1338601
address 1DhWwknaiVPThYbGNSD8usyULeSQwejyjX